Murray Building Approved for Historic Tax Credits

The Murray Building in Peoria’s Warehouse District has been approved by the National Parks Service for its design and construction methods as they relate to the Historic Tax Credit program.   

The CEO of the property management team heading up the redevelopment of the building says the Historic Tax Credits are significant to the feasibility of the Murray Place project.   

He says the approval of Tax Credits lays the groundwork going forward.

The Murray Building renovations are turning the old retail outlet into a mixed-use building.

Rhodell’s Brewery is on the first floor, with additional retail and commercial space extending to the second floor. Apartments are planned for the third and fourth floors.

Farnsworth Group is planning to move into the building at the end of August. Residential space is expected to be ready in the fall.
